This 1961 Cessna 182D, offered at $119,000 and priced to sell, presents a well-equipped example with a strong panel and recent maintenance. The airframe shows 3,600 total hours, with the engine having 740 hours since major overhaul and the propeller 570 hours since new. Recent attention to the ignition system includes a new 500-hour magneto inspection, new harness, new spark plugs, and a new starter, along with a plug-in heater.
